Output 03df30603f111b65949ee64b50d9511f73d8645a84d7f30516fcc1bb71bd840c:8

value
1743390
script pubkey
OP_0 OP_PUSHBYTES_20 a1881f71b0e36aaac93656d18e83e0a32e22a84e
address
ltc1q5xyp7udsud424jfk2mgcaqlq5vhz92zwu2jn5w
transaction
03df30603f111b65949ee64b50d9511f73d8645a84d7f30516fcc1bb71bd840c
spent
true